Step 4: Deploying the Routefox assignment heuristic. After the canary batch passes, push the heuristic bundle to the Dispatchly staging cluster and confirm the match-rate dashboard stays above baseline for 15 minutes. New joiners: the heuristic weights ship as a sealed artifact, so the pipeline will refuse unsigned bundles. Before promoting to production, verify the artifact against the key below.

signing key of hahag-tahag = bky4_v18e

Fix applied: all agents now sync against the internal Pellstone NTP pool with a 5-second drift alarm. Two agents (bld-07, bld-11) were reimaged after persistent drift. No evidence of tampering; logs attached. Security review required before we close, since timestamp validation was bypassed for three builds. Those builds have been quarantined pending re-sign. Sign-off requested from the reviewer's counterpart named below.

account owner for bawip-tahag: Raleth Quenok

/*
 * Client setup for the Tilecrest prefetcher.
 *
 * This block initializes the connection to the Atlasgrove tile service,
 * which we use to warm the cache for map regions flagged as high-traffic.
 * The prefetcher runs on a fixed schedule and must authenticate with a
 * service-scoped credential — user tokens will be rejected with a 403.
 * Keep concurrency at or below 8 to respect Atlasgrove's internal quota.
 * The staging credential used by this client is defined below.
 */

gateway credential: qvz23-yxEt4ZpI2FqWW5Nukj2F3vS